At a gentle 60 BPM, "Hanson Place" by R. Lowry evokes a serene and contemplative mood, perfectly complemented by its key of D and a steady 4/4 time signature. This hymn-style piece invites listeners to reflect and find solace in its melodic simplicity, showcasing the beauty of acoustic grand piano instrumentation.
From a technical standpoint, this MIDI composition features a note count of 267 within a brief duration of just 1:04.
